Carpet Reinforcement
Carpet Reinforcement can be defined as Unidirectional reinforcement
bars in roll form - Carpet
Carpets are formed by wire spinning for easy rolling & adjustment
onsite
Carpets can be rolled out at right angles to each other to form different
layers of reinforcement
Widely used in Scandinavia & Australia
Applications:
Raft foundations, Large Pile Caps, Basement / Heavy Slabs, RC Walls,
MRT Stations (UG / AG), Cut & Cover Tunnels, Roads, Bridge Decks etc
Benefits
Benefits
Reduction of laying Time by about 70-80% Vs Cut & Bent loose bars
laying
Reduction of on-site Workers by about 60% Vs Cut & Bent loose bars
laying
Scheduling (BBS) & Installation Drawings done by trained engineers
at NatSteel
